部署失败的常见表现
当腾讯云SSL证书部署失败时,通常伴随以下现象:浏览器提示”无法建立安全连接”、服务器返回ERR_SSL_PROTOCOL_ERROR错误、控制台显示443端口未响应。这些症状往往指向端口未开放或配置错误两类核心问题。
端口未开放排查方案
HTTPS通信依赖443端口正常工作,需按顺序执行以下检查:
- 通过
netstat -tuln | grep 443
命令验证端口监听状态 - 检查云服务器安全组设置,添加TCP 443入站规则
- 在防火墙中放行443端口流量(Linux执行
sudo ufw allow 443/tcp
)
配置错误修复指南
针对Nginx/Apache服务器的常见配置问题:
- 证书路径错误:检查
ssl_certificate
和ssl_certificate_key
指向的文件路径 - 私钥不匹配:使用OpenSSL验证证书与私钥的MD5值是否一致
- 协议版本过低:禁用SSLv3,启用TLS 1.2+协议
证书链完整性验证
不完整的证书链会导致浏览器信任验证失败,需执行:
- 从腾讯云控制台下载包含中间证书的完整证书包
- 将中间证书合并到服务器证书文件(
cat certificate.crt intermediate.crt > fullchain.crt
) - 使用SSL Labs测试工具验证证书链完整性
SSL证书部署失败多由基础设施配置或证书管理不当引起。通过系统性排查端口状态、配置文件语法、证书链完整性,配合腾讯云提供的诊断工具,可快速定位并解决部署问题。建议定期使用自动化检测工具监控证书有效期和服务状态。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/615576.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。